a certain solution has a molarity of m = 6.39 mol/l and has a volume of v =0.550 l what is the value of n

n = 3.49 mol

Molarity = moles/litres or c = n/V

n = Vc  = 0.550 L × (6.39 mol/1 L) = 3.49 mol
